前後のアプレットパラメータは、端末を実現することができる二次元コードを生成することができ、それはパスの前方側の後端部によって生成された方がよいことは方法である私は、生成キャリーパラメータシーンの先端部の先端は、通常の長さの制限共有を持って紹介します需要が達成することができ、公式文書が記述されています。
同じフロントエンドインターフェースはまた、公式要求することによって得ることが、小さな手順のaccess_tokenはパラメータバックエンド開発を得る必要があるすべての最初のパラメータで2次元コードの小さなプログラムを取得するために、トークンが非常に簡単である公式インターフェースへの直接の呼び出しを行った(注のリターンことフロントエンド・フォーマットは、それが、その後、バックエンドデータベースに直接格納することができるされている場合フォーマットは問題に対処するであろうように、表示画像を着手する)フロントエンドと変換画像フォーマットを
小さなアプリケーションをテストするために、開発者は、権限の内側を持っています
取得access_tokenは
/ ** *取得access_tokenは* * * @paramappid @paramappsecret * @リターン* /
公式文書 GET access_tokenは
wx.request({
URL: 'https://api.weixin.qq.com/cgi-bin/token?grant_type=client_credential&appid=wx9743427e009a5d0&secret=decff2504655b08ec20260e3699039c'
方法:「取得」、
成功:機能(RES){
console.log(RES)
}
})
GETアプレットaccess_tokenはGET二次元コードは、(元のデータが二値画像である)リクエストメソッドarraybufferのフォーマットを戻すために設けられています。
公式文書 の二次元コードを取得するためのアプレット
= {データを聞かせ
シーン:「123456」は、パラメータが渡されます
ページ:「ページ/ hotinfo / hotinfo」、アプレットページへのスキャンコード
}
wx.request({
URL: 'https://api.weixin.qq.com/wxa/getwxacodeunlimit?access_token=31_92uKEw2joJRdBP75gViNwBwZu-LGZ4-99EwkjpOy-iT3yW4B4Q7e_iscapbVQ3uIBoJXdo5sv0IJVyz8e6XfxAZHAbmmSFi8W1Fhu-OTSNJBQ57_h0aOlfjUIxChman-gaxZy_XOQVgdwpJ8DTRaAFAJZX'
方法:「ポスト」
日付:日付、
//データ型: 'JSON'
responseType:「arraybuffer」、 //テキスト修正arraybufferを解析することによってデータを返します
成功:機能(RES){
console.log()
self.setData({
//表示画像は再びBASE64にarraybuffer
URL: 'データ:画像/ PNG; base64で、' + wx.arrayBufferToBase64(res.data)
})
}
})